Arizona Science Teachers Association: Priority vs. Essential – Clarifying Standards to Strengthen Science Instruction

August 28, 2025 @ 10:30 am - 11:00 am

Free

Have you ever asked whether Arizona’s Science Standards identify essential or priority standards like Math and ELA do? In this session, participants will examine how the Arizona Science Standards (AzSS) differ from other content areas in their approach to identifying priority vs essential standards.

We’ll discuss how understanding this distinction can support effective instructional planning. The session will also highlight how engineering-focused performance expectations are integrated throughout the AzSS, helping administrators support teachers in recognizing and leveraging these embedded opportunities.
